OVERVIEW OF THE USTA/MIDWEST SECTION
The USTA/Midwest Section exceeds 70,000 individual and 930 organizational members. It is the second largest section of the United States Tennis Association, the National Governing Body for tennis in the U.S. The association is comprised of 13 districts in the following states: Illinois, Indiana, Michigan, Ohio and Wisconsin as well as designated counties in West Virginia and Kentucky. The USTA/Midwest Section offers recreational and competitive tennis opportunities for individuals of all ages and abilities. SUMMARY OF FUNCTIONS:

The primary focus of the Tennis Service Representative (TSR) is to uphold the mission of the USTA in promoting and developing growth of tennis within a designated region. Extensive travel throughout the TSR’s respective geographic territory providing service, consultation and business strategies to their customers. Work with individual facilities / organizations and provide personalized service and support to the people who operate them.

The service and support provided can take many different forms including but not limited to: helping to lead and organize the development of programs and volunteer recruitment; assistance with event marketing; timely awareness of available grants or resources; connection to local or national knowledge experts within a specific field or program area; helping to implement community events with large numbers of participants. The service is delivered through all avenues of the tennis delivery system including but not limited to schools, parks, service organizations or clubs by traveling a minimum of three days per week all year.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:

1. Conduct regular prospecting, sales calls and meetings with tennis providers and organizations designed to increase tennis participation, play frequency and introducing new participants to tennis by attracting new, former, adaptive and underserved audiences.
2. Responsible for in-depth program development, support, and assistance
3. Provide facilities and organizations (clients) with relevant program information, marketing materials, grant information and other resources as needed and requested.
4. Responsible for administrative reporting, phone calls, data entry, conference calls, webinars and trainings as required.
5. Represent the USTA/Midwest Section by attending, coordinating and/or delivering workshops, special events, conferences and booth duties designed to strengthen the delivery system and increase participation in tennis.
6. Responsible for special events, conferences, and booth duties
7. Work in positive and cooperative manner with USTA Section, District and national staff and volunteers.
8. Requires extensive travel via automobile
9. Various other job duties as required
